About Us

​Martina has over 20 years experience in delivering restorative processes and training to schools, criminal justice, workplaces and sports organisations on the island of Ireland and further afield, including various European countries and South East Asia. 

​Martina is an approved trainer with the European Forum for Restorative Justice, and the Restorative Justice Council, UK. She is also an Associate with HSC Leadership Centre (NI). Martina's associates are highly experienced, accredited facilitators, with decades of experience in the field of RP/RJ. 


The focus of Martina's training is on creating healthier and happier relationships with an emphasis on using restorative approaches as both a preventative and reactive response to conflict and wrongdoing. 

Martina has been a qualified social worker for over 25 years and was the first in Europe to achieve a Post Graduate Diploma in Restorative Practices (Ulster University, 2007). She is also trained to OCN Level 4 Systemic and Group Mediation.
